Technical Field
The invention belongs to the field of building construction, and particularly relates to a curtain wall construction system and method suitable for a high-rise building with a special-shaped giant column.
Background
In the prior art, the hanging basket is installed through a cantilever frame at the position of a roof or a floor plate, the number of cantilever frames arranged on the roof of a common building is large, workers can stand in the hanging basket to operate, the construction time of the curtain wall is influenced by the construction progress of a main body structure, and the total height of the building cannot be too high; meanwhile, the vertical transportation of curtain wall materials is more and more common by adopting rail hoisting, and usually, a cantilever frame is arranged on a roof, a hanging basket is hung on the outer side, curtain wall materials are hoisted by the inner side rail, and construction is carried out around floors along the rail.
In the field of curtain wall construction of super high-rise buildings, the measure of the synergistic effect of the hanging basket and the rail is also a commonly adopted construction method, but the main technical difficulty lies in the installation positions of the rail platform and the hanging basket, how to install and shift, meanwhile, the high wind pressure safety of high-altitude construction of the super high-rise buildings needs to be considered, how to construct simultaneously with the main structure to ensure the timeliness, and if the position of a non-floor plate such as a wall surface cylinder is met, what reasonable construction measure is adopted is the difficult problem in the field of curtain walls of the super high-rise buildings at present.

Detailed Description
For a fuller understanding of the technical content of the present invention, reference should be made to the following detailed description taken together with the accompanying drawings.
Example 1
As shown in fig. 1-4, the embodiment provides a curtain wall construction system suitable for a high-rise building with special-shaped huge columns, comprising a plurality of embedded pieces 11 embedded in the special-shaped huge columns 1 and protruding out of the surfaces of the special-shaped huge columns 1, wherein the embedded pieces 11 are arranged up and down, the embedded pieces 11 are fixedly connected with a connecting support 12, the other end of the connecting support 12 is connected with a climbing frame 2 arranged along the special-shaped huge columns, a temporary hanging steel frame 21 is arranged on the special-shaped huge columns 1 and behind the climbing frame 2, the temporary hanging steel frame 21 is movably connected with the special-shaped huge columns 1 through bolts, the front end of the temporary hanging steel frame 21 protrudes out of the climbing frame 2, the front end of the temporary hanging steel frame 21 is provided with a temporary hanging point 22 for hanging a hanging basket 4, a track overhanging platform 3 is arranged below the climbing frame 2 on the special-shaped huge columns 1, at least one hanging basket 4 hung outside the bottom of the track overhanging platform 3 through a first steel wire rope 41 is arranged below the track overhanging platform 3, an electric hoist 39 for hoisting curtain wall materials is slidably arranged at the middle position of the bottom of the rail overhanging platform 3.
Specifically, the climbing frame 2 comprises a climbing rail 23 connected with the connecting support 12, a climbing frame steel frame 24 is fixedly connected to the outer side of the climbing rail 23, and a plurality of layers of climbing frame pedals 25 are arranged at intervals on the inner side of the climbing frame steel frame 24, so that the climbing frame steel frame 24 forms a multi-layer structure required by construction personnel to stand during construction; in the structure, the climbing rail 23 can be matched with the connecting support 12 through hydraulic pressure, an electric hoist or manual mode to drive the climbing frame steel frame 24 to perform lifting motion, so that the whole climbing frame 2 performs lifting motion, and the multilayer climbing frame pedal 25 can facilitate the construction operation of construction personnel such as wall heat preservation and plastering in the climbing frame.
Specifically, be equipped with the protection network 26 in the outside of climbing frame steelframe 24, the protection network 26 can prevent that finishing material from falling the outside scope outside of climbing frame 2, ensures ground personnel's safety, and the protection network 26 can provide certain guard action for the constructor simultaneously, and the front end of hanging steelframe 21 temporarily outwards stretches out outside the protection network 26, hangs the outside that the point 22 is located the protection network 26 temporarily.
Specifically, the track platform 3 of encorbelmenting includes a plurality of cantilever vaulting poles 31 of locating perpendicularly on the huge post of dysmorphism 1, the medial extremity and the huge post 1 swing joint of dysmorphism of cantilever vaulting pole 31, be equipped with the second wire rope 32 that the tilt up set up between the outside end of cantilever vaulting pole 31 and the huge post of dysmorphism 1 for the taut cantilever vaulting pole of slant provides pulling force for the cantilever vaulting pole, first wire rope 41 hangs on the cantilever vaulting pole, the outside of cantilever vaulting pole 31 receives the decurrent power that hanging flower basket 4 applyed, utilize second wire rope 32 can provide ascending pulling force for cantilever vaulting pole 31, guarantee the security that hanging flower basket 4 hung.
Specifically, a first steel wire rope lock 13 is arranged below the climbing frame 2 on the special-shaped large column 1 through a buckle movable connection, a second steel wire rope lock 14 is arranged at the outer side end of the cantilever support rod 31 through a buckle movable connection, two ends of a second steel wire rope 32 are respectively connected with the first steel wire rope lock 13 and the second steel wire rope lock 14, and the cantilever support rod 31 is pulled to be in a horizontal state by providing upward pulling force for the cantilever support rod 31 through the second steel wire rope 32.
Specifically, a safety pull rod 33 which is obliquely arranged upwards is further arranged between the outer side end of the cantilever brace 31 and the special-shaped giant column 1, two ends of the safety pull rod 33 are respectively connected with the cantilever brace 31 and the special-shaped giant column 1 in a rotating manner, and the safety pull rod 33 is arranged below the second steel wire rope 32; when the second steel wire rope 32 provides an upward pulling force for the cantilever brace 31 to make the cantilever brace 31 parallel to the horizontal plane, in order to ensure the safety, the safety pull rod 33 is arranged to provide a second upward pulling force for the cantilever brace 31, and the two pulling forces provided by the second steel wire rope 32 and the safety pull rod 33 form double safety for the cantilever brace 31, so that the potential safety hazard caused by the fact that one pulling force suddenly disappears in an emergency situation is prevented.
Specifically, the track overhanging platform 3 further comprises a scaffold board 34 which is arranged on the upper ends of the plurality of cantilever support rods 31 in a spanning mode and surrounds the specially-shaped giant column 1, and the scaffold board 34 is carried on the cantilever support rods 31 to form a construction platform for constructors.
Specifically, a guard rail 37 is further provided at the upper end of the outer side of the scaffold board 34, so as to enclose the outer side of the scaffold board 34 to form a protection area, thereby providing safety protection for a constructor standing on the scaffold board 34 for construction; and the guard rail 37 is a net-shaped guard rail structure formed by connecting a plurality of vertical bars and a plurality of cross bars in a criss-cross manner.
Specifically, a distribution track 38 arranged around the special-shaped large column 1 is arranged at the middle position of the bottom of the cantilever support rod 31, the electric hoist 39 is arranged on the distribution track 38 in a sliding mode, and materials such as installation materials can be distributed and transported by moving the electric hoist 39 on the distribution track 38.
Specifically, a construction hanging point 40 is arranged at one end of the cantilever brace 31 far away from the special-shaped giant column 1, the hanging basket 4 is hung on the construction hanging point 40 through a first steel wire rope 41, and the upper end of the first steel wire rope 41 is hung on the construction hanging point 40 and then is locked and fixed through a fixing buckle.
Specifically, two ends of the basket 4 are respectively provided with a hanging part 42, each hanging part 42 is provided with a lifter 43 for winding a first steel wire rope, the lower end of the first steel wire rope 41 penetrates through the top end of the hanging part 42 and then is connected with the lifter 43, and the first steel wire rope 41 is wound or loosened by the lifter 43 to move the basket 4 up and down so that the basket 4 moves to a required construction position.
In the embodiment, the hanging basket 4 is a special-shaped hanging basket, the specific shape of the hanging basket 4 is determined by the shape of the special-shaped giant column 1, and the shape of the hanging basket 4 is matched with the shape of the outer wall of the special-shaped giant column 1, so that the same distance from any position in the hanging basket 4 to the surface of the special-shaped giant column 1 is ensured for construction workers to conveniently construct; when the outer wall of the special-shaped giant column 1 is provided with a corner, and the corner is an obtuse angle, the hanging basket 4 is a zigzag hanging basket, and the angle of the zigzag is the same as that of the corner on the surface of the special-shaped giant column 1, so that the convenience of construction workers is ensured.
Example 2
The embodiment provides a curtain wall construction method suitable for a high-rise building with an opposite giant column, which comprises the following steps:
s1, mounting a climbing frame on the special-shaped giant column;
s2, building a temporary hanging steel frame for hanging a hanging basket on the special-shaped large column on the inner side of the hanging basket through a climbing frame;
s3, hanging the hanging basket on a temporary hanging point at the outer side end of the temporary hanging steel frame through a steel wire rope;
s4, building a track overhanging platform on the special-shaped giant column through the hanging basket;
s5, changing the steel wire rope for hanging the hanging basket from the temporary hanging point to a construction hanging point at the outer side end of the track overhanging platform;
s6, dismantling the temporary hanging steel frame;
s7, hoisting the curtain wall material to the front of a hanging basket through an electric hoist at the bottom of the rail overhanging platform, and then standing the hanging basket by constructors to carry out curtain wall installation construction operation;
s8, after the curtain wall installation construction operation of the construction section is completed, the climbing frame ascends through the climbing rail on the climbing frame;
and S9, repeating the steps S2 to S8 until the curtain wall construction work of all construction sections is completed.
Specifically, step S1 includes the following steps:
s11, embedding and fixing the connecting support on the special-shaped giant column in advance;
s12, assembling and fixing the climbing rail, the climbing frame steel frame, the climbing frame pedal and the protective net to form a climbing frame;
s13, then the climbing rail is connected with the connecting support in a matching way, so that the climbing frame is installed on the special-shaped giant column;
specifically, step S4 includes the following steps:
s41, fixing one end of a cantilever brace rod on a special-shaped giant column by a constructor standing in the hanging basket;
s42, sequentially mounting a cable wire and a safety pull rod which are inclined to one another between the outer side end of the cantilever brace rod and the special-shaped giant column;
s43, installing a dispatching track and an electric hoist in the middle of the bottom of the cantilever brace rod;
s44, mounting a scaffold board arranged around the special-shaped giant column at the upper end of the cantilever support rod;
and S45, mounting a guard rail at the upper end of the outer side of the scaffold board.
In the above embodiment, the nacelle 4 may be hung at the temporary hanging point 22 and the construction hanging point 40 by the first steel wire rope 41, the first steel wire rope 41 is composed of the main rope and the auxiliary rope, when the nacelle 4 needs to be changed from the temporary hanging point 22 to the construction hanging point 40, the auxiliary rope and the nacelle 4 are clamped by the anchor clamp, then the main rope is changed, and after the main rope is changed from the temporary hanging point 22 to the construction hanging point 40, the auxiliary rope is changed until the rope changing operation is completed.
In conclusion, the climbing frame 2 is firstly installed, the climbing frame 2 is fixed on the special-shaped giant column 1 through the matching of the climbing rail 23 and the connecting support 12, so that construction workers can perform construction operations such as wall surface heat preservation, plastering and the like on the construction section where the climbing frame 2 is located, and a temporary hanging steel frame 21 is built through the climbing frame 2, a temporary hanging point 22 is arranged on the temporary hanging steel frame 21, the hanging basket 4 is hung on the temporary hanging point 22, at the moment, a constructor stands in the hanging basket 4 to build the track overhanging platform 3 and arrange a construction hanging point 40, after the track overhanging platform 3 is built, the gondola 4 is transferred from the temporary suspension point 22 to the construction suspension point 40 by a rope change operation, then the temporary hanging steel frame 21 is dismantled, at the moment, a constructor can stand in the hanging basket 4 to carry out curtain wall installation construction operation of the construction section, and the allocation and transportation track 38 can carry out allocation and transportation of materials such as installation materials for the construction operation through the electric hoist 39; after the curtain wall installation construction operation of the construction section is finished, the climbing frame 2 is ascended for a distance, and the steps are repeated to perform the curtain wall installation construction operation of the next construction section until all the curtain wall installation construction operations are finished.
